    Start-up companies represent one of the most dynamic drivers of growth in today’s economy. The period from conception through funding, growth, and sale can be rapid, and a misstep at any stage in the company’s life-cycle can mark the difference between success and failure. Lawyers counseling these companies and the entrepreneurs who found them are immersed in an exciting, fun practice area—which, at times, can place the lawyer in the role of business coach, cheerleader, match-maker, and legal counselor. A sage maxim often attributed to Benjamin Franklin counsels that “Failing to plan is planning to fail.” Get the foundation you need to succeed at MCLE.
